Upcycled Tin Can Lanterns with Cute Cutouts

Upcycled Tin Can Lanterns with Cute Cutouts

Turn old tin cans into pretty lanterns for your garden! Just take a clean can, fill it with water, and freeze it. Once it’s frozen, take it out and gently tap the can to remove it. Use a hammer and a nail to poke little holes in it, making fun patterns like hearts or stars. When you’re done, put a small candle inside and place it in your garden. As night falls, the candle will glow through the holes, making a cozy and magical light show. It’s a simple idea that adds charm to any outdoor space!
